

The Grade School PTC communicates with parents, teachers, and the Riverdale community in the following ways:
The PTC holds at least three (3) General Meetings during the school year. Meetings are announced two (2) weeks in advance in parent pack. Occasionally there will be scheduled public speakers, Q&A with the Principal, etc. Meeting agendas and minutes are posted on the Meetings/Minutes page.
The PTC publishes an email weekly newsletter. This email is sent every Friday to let the Riverdale community know the latest events and PTC related information. This is a must read if you want to know what is happening at the school and in the district and community.
The PTC website (www.riverdaleptc.org) is updated continuously throughout the year with the latest school and PTC information. It has links to the numerous volunteer opportunities at the school and surrounding events, as well as the PTC Store (where you can pay annual PTC fees, purchase tickets to Party Packs, Ladies’ Stag, Carnival, etc.), and links to register for Community School, as well as other helpful school information. Over the course of the year, if your email address changes, please notify the PTC Communications chair at: RGSCommunications@riverdaleptc.org
There are two Grade School bulletin boards for parents to peruse: One inside located across from the Preschool classroom and one exterior bulletin board adjacent to the bicycle pavilion near the playground.
The PTC Vice President will, from time to time, communicate urgent or time sensitive event or other PTC-related information via the Room Parent Communications point people. The Room Parent Communications point person is selected around the Back-to-School timeframe and are the keepers of their classroom’s email and contact list. They are responsible for disseminating communications from the PTC Vice President or the Teacher to their class parents as requested.
